我想在一些html标记中使用if语句。
但是当我发送邮件时,"键入"是空的,它根本不发送。
这是在某些html电子邮件标记中使用if else语句的正确方法吗?
$e_body = "Er is contact opgenomen door $name." . PHP_EOL . PHP_EOL;
$e_content = "<br><br>
Gegevens:<br>
Naam: $name <br>
E-mail: $email <br>
Tel: $phone <br>";
if(isset($_POST['werkzaamheden'])){
'Type: $select <br>';
}else{
'Type: Niet van toepassing';
}"
" . PHP_EOL . PHP_EOL;
$e_reply = " Onderwerp: $email2
<br>
$commentsb<br> ";
}
$msg = wordwrap( $e_body . $e_content . $e_reply, 70 );
答案 0 :(得分:1)
您需要连接字符串。所以而不是:
if(isset($_POST['werkzaamheden'])){
'Type: $select <br>';
}else{
'Type: Niet van toepassing';
}"
你应该
if(isset($_POST['werkzaamheden'])){
$e_content .= 'Type: $select <br>';
}else{
$e_content .= 'Type: Niet van toepassing';
}"